Enum marlowe_lang::semantics::AppliedInput
source · pub enum AppliedInput {
Choice(ChoiceId, i128),
Deposit(Party, AccountId, Token, u128),
}
Variants§
Trait Implementations§
source§impl Clone for AppliedInput
impl Clone for AppliedInput
source§fn clone(&self) -> AppliedInput
fn clone(&self) -> AppliedInput
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for AppliedInput
impl Debug for AppliedInput
source§impl<'de> Deserialize<'de> for AppliedInput
impl<'de> Deserialize<'de> for AppliedInput
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for AppliedInput
impl RefUnwindSafe for AppliedInput
impl Send for AppliedInput
impl Sync for AppliedInput
impl Unpin for AppliedInput
impl UnwindSafe for AppliedInput
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more